Transaction 666305802719f24f4fa30bc6356f99e5c1ae4fa9a1f38c2ff2ea5423461b53d4
1 Input
1 Output
-
666305802719f24f4fa30bc6356f99e5c1ae4fa9a1f38c2ff2ea5423461b53d4:0
- value
- 174138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f126fd342f11f47fcfc82258dc5705874625dcd OP_EQUAL
- address
- 334i9S7LvYSRr3F58i4iQKdsQFjB5g1182